Tucker County Courthouse

Architect - Frank Pierce Milburn

Built 1898 - c. 1900The original county seat at St. George was forcibly moved to Parsons at night on August 1, 1893. With the construction of the brick courthouse hopes of the return to St. George ...

Shelby County Courthouse

1854-1908

Original seat of government of Shelby County established 1818 at Shelbyville (Pelham).

Moved to Columbiana 1826. First courthouse a small wooden building located on this site. Replaced 1854 by two-story brick structure which forms central portion of this building. ...
